(window.webpackWcBlocksJsonp=window.webpackWcBlocksJsonp||[]).push([[8],{317:function(t,e){},318:function(t,e,c){"use strict";c.d(e,"a",(function(){return u}));var o=c(0),n=c(9),r=c(6),a=c(19),d=c(22),i=c(32);const s=(t,e)=>{const c=t.find(t=>{let{id:c}=t;return c===e});return c?c.quantity:0},u=t=>{const{addItemToCart:e}=Object(n.useDispatch)(r.CART_STORE_KEY),{cartItems:c,cartIsLoading:u}=Object(d.a)(),{addErrorNotice:l,removeNotice:b}=Object(i.a)(),[p,f]=Object(o.useState)(!1),m=Object(o.useRef)(s(c,t));return Object(o.useEffect)(()=>{const e=s(c,t);e!==m.current&&(m.current=e)},[c,t]),{cartQuantity:Number.isFinite(m.current)?m.current:0,addingToCart:p,cartIsLoading:u,addToCart:function(){let c=arguments.length>0&&void 0!==arguments[0]?arguments[0]:1;return f(!0),e(t,c).then(()=>{b("add-to-cart")}).catch(t=>{l(Object(a.decodeEntities)(t.message),{context:"wc/all-products",id:"add-to-cart",isDismissible:!0})}).finally(()=>{f(!1)})}}}},32:function(t,e,c){"use strict";c.d(e,"a",(function(){return r}));var o=c(0),n=c(87);const r=()=>{const{notices:t,createNotice:e,removeNotice:c,setIsSuppressed:r}=Object(n.b)(),a=Object(o.useRef)(t);Object(o.useEffect)(()=>{a.current=t},[t]);const d=Object(o.useMemo)(()=>({hasNoticesOfType:t=>a.current.some(e=>e.type===t),removeNotices:function(){let t=arguments.length>0&&void 0!==arguments[0]?arguments[0]:null;a.current.forEach(e=>{null!==t&&e.status!==t||c(e.id)})},removeNotice:c}),[c]),i=Object(o.useMemo)(()=>({addDefaultNotice:function(t){let c=arguments.length>1&&void 0!==arguments[1]?arguments[1]:{};e("default",t,{...c})},addErrorNotice:function(t){let c=arguments.length>1&&void 0!==arguments[1]?arguments[1]:{};e("error",t,{...c})},addWarningNotice:function(t){let c=arguments.length>1&&void 0!==arguments[1]?arguments[1]:{};e("warning",t,{...c})},addInfoNotice:function(t){let c=arguments.length>1&&void 0!==arguments[1]?arguments[1]:{};e("info",t,{...c})},addSuccessNotice:function(t){let c=arguments.length>1&&void 0!==arguments[1]?arguments[1]:{};e("success",t,{...c})}}),[e]);return{notices:t,...d,...i,setIsSuppressed:r}}},366:function(t,e,c){"use strict";c.r(e);var o=c(10),n=c.n(o),r=c(0),a=(c(8),c(4)),d=c.n(a),i=c(1),s=c(38),u=c(318),l=c(19),b=c(49),p=c(110);c(317);const f=t=>{let{product:e}=t;const{id:c,permalink:o,add_to_cart:a,has_options:b,is_purchasable:p,is_in_stock:f}=e,{dispatchStoreEvent:m}=Object(s.a)(),{cartQuantity:O,addingToCart:_,addToCart:j}=Object(u.a)(c),k=Number.isFinite(O)&&O>0,w=!b&&p&&f,g=Object(l.decodeEntities)((null==a?void 0:a.description)||""),h=k?Object(i.sprintf)(
/* translators: %s number of products in cart. */
Object(i._n)("%d in cart","%d in cart",O,'woocommerce'),O):Object(l.decodeEntities)((null==a?void 0:a.text)||Object(i.__)("Add to cart",'woocommerce')),v=w?"button":"a",N={};return w?N.onClick=()=>{j(),m("cart-add-item",{product:e})}:(N.href=o,N.rel="nofollow",N.onClick=()=>{m("product-view-link",{product:e})}),Object(r.createElement)(v,n()({"aria-label":g,className:d()("wp-block-button__link","add_to_cart_button","wc-block-components-product-button__button",{loading:_,added:k}),disabled:_},N),h)},m=()=>Object(r.createElement)("button",{className:d()("wp-block-button__link","add_to_cart_button","wc-block-components-product-button__button","wc-block-components-product-button__button--placeholder"),disabled:!0});e.default=Object(p.withProductDataContext)(t=>{let{className:e}=t;const{parentClassName:c}=Object(b.useInnerBlockLayoutContext)(),{product:o}=Object(b.useProductDataContext)();return Object(r.createElement)("div",{className:d()(e,"wp-block-button","wc-block-components-product-button",{[c+"__product-add-to-cart"]:c})},o.id?Object(r.createElement)(f,{product:o}):Object(r.createElement)(m,null))})}}]);
12bet Casino No Deposit Bonus Codes For Free Spins 2025
By
12bet Casino No Deposit Bonus Codes For Free Spins 2025
12bet casino no deposit bonus codes for free spins 2025 firstly, the bonanza can get bigger fast. There is a cornucopia of promotions at online casinos, there is a wide selection of table games for you to test out. While playing Blade gives you an unique way to score really outstanding amounts of credits, that doesnt mean that you cannot play games on your Android or iOS mobile devices.
Online Casino Real Money No Deposit Uk
No Deposit Free Chips United Kingdom 2025
12bet casino no deposit bonus codes for free spins 2025
Slots free spins no deposit uk
The different casino bonuses.
Instant online casinos United Kingdom
This means you can enjoy the experience of playing poker without having to waste some of your valuable time, Novomatic.
This will very much be a luxury style casino for the Old Dominion, which webpages you end up spending the most amount of time and which banner ads receive the most clicks. Members get bonuses based on their playing activity in addition to the original sign up bonus which helps to propel your online game experience, or whether it will be tied.
Megapari is a legitimate online casino website with different games from many reputable game providers, keep on reading and stick to the presented guidelines from the later on.
You can review these for free or play for real money, the app allows you to play poker games whether you are using an iPhone.
What is the best table game in online casino? Also, excruciating losses and impactful news in the gaming industry. The only significant disadvantage associated with real money blackjack is that you stand to lose money, there are the VideoSlots tournaments.
Super Casino Online United Kingdom
12bet casino no deposit bonus codes for free spins 2025
Joe fortune casino uk
United Kingdom Casino £10 Free
Lets start by weighing down the pluses and minuses of Virgin Bet UK, issues. The main difference between modern analogs is their availability since customers can play anywhere, or concerns. They can be used to place wagers on different sporting events, see our dedicated page on the topic. Can I Play Princess Warrior Slots for Free, new casino sites UK no wagering requirements but they all pay out. Blackjack online free UK the Department of Treasury and Federal Reserve board were also required to regulate inside of 9 months after enactment, giving the Clippers a real edge here. 12bet casino no deposit bonus codes for free spins 2025 in addition to unique themes, there are no tried and true methods or strategies since slots are controlled by RNGs.
New British casinos 2025 with real money bonuses
You just need to select a foreign online gambling site that is UK gambler-friendly, while the rest of the money is distributed to the best ranked players. Less often, best United Kingdom online casino fast payout 2025 it is accepted by some pretty amazing American Express Casinos. While this is a lengthy offer, but ELK Studios doesnt pale in comparison to the giants of the industry. The symbols in Kingdom of Titans are a laurel wreath, the Curacao Government.
Non-UK gambling sites are known for their generous bonus policy, theres other strategic games like the slotfather boss buster claw and ultimate complement is tribute and genuine slot machine poker lessons styles its not bad value.
Deprecated: Function the_block_template_skip_link is deprecated since version 6.4.0! Use wp_enqueue_block_template_skip_link() instead. in /home/v98g1rmn00sa/public_html/nfcap.org/wp-includes/functions.php on line 6085